Nestled in the picturesque Marina da Glória, Corrientes 348 offers discerning luxury travelers an authentic taste of Argentine culinary tradition against the stunning backdrop of Guanabara Bay. This acclaimed steakhouse, a Michelin Guide Recommended establishment, transports diners to the heart of Buenos Aires with its sophisticated yet inviting ambiance and dedication to the art of the parrilla. The interior, thoughtfully designed by Zeh Arquitetura, features elegant wood accents, spacious dining rooms, and an impressive glass-fronted wine cellar, creating an atmosphere that is both refined and warm.
At Corrientes 348, the focus is on premium, award-winning Argentine meats, meticulously prepared over an open-flame parrilla. Guests can indulge in exceptional cuts such as the succulent Ancho steak, the flavorful 348 Assado de Tira (flank steak), and the tender Matambrito (cap of rib), all served with a variety of traditional sides designed for sharing. The culinary journey is complemented by a carefully curated wine list and classic Argentine beverages. To conclude the experience, the irresistible dulce de leche pancake served with ice cream provides a quintessential sweet note.
